Output dd23d8bd886efa09800c50a01343e9dddbdf23a76578119b47df7cdbf299fbc3:0

value
27192078656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d71844bf3fee268880917e3e5ca403baa891e77 OP_EQUALVERIFY OP_CHECKSIG
address
1JGghYLp1KLBamt2Vp938EHXw55Kmehphy
transaction
dd23d8bd886efa09800c50a01343e9dddbdf23a76578119b47df7cdbf299fbc3
spent
true